The history of Sri Ramakrishana Gurukula Vidyamandiram begins with a great benevolent personality named Swami Thyageesanandaji Maharaj, who dedicated his life for the upliftment of the downtrodden. He was an advocate but after embracing Sanyasa he dedicated his life to teaching. Swamiji witnessed the miserable conditions of the members of the backward community in Puranattukara. Realizing the importance of education he consulted sri Appan Thampuram one of the members of The Cochin Royal family to find a solution for the betterment of the poor people. Sri Appanthampuran extended his full support and sri Bhaskaran [who became swami Krithatmanandaji later] informed them about a piece of land which belonged to Sri Pattiakkal Thomakutty at Puranatukara.

The land was purchased for Rs 200 .On June 1st 1927, Sri Ramakrishna Gurukulam became a reality. Classes 1 and 2 started simultaneously. Sri Appan Thampuran was the first Manager, Sri Sivarama Menon the first Head Master and the teachers were Sri Echara Warrier,Sankara Warrier and Ambady Narayana Menon .Along with the school was established a Sanskrit Padashala, Weaving classes ,Stone cutting society and the Gurukulam hostel. In 1932 it became a high school.

21 students appeared for the first SSLC examination and 18 students came out with first class .Now there are nearly 3000 students and 100 staff members.Acadamic, Curricular, Co-curricular activities go hand in hand. Both English and Malayalam medium classes function smoothly with the grace of Sri Ramakrishna .We maintain quality and discipline. Preference is given to Scheduled Caste, Scheduled Tribe and other backward communities .Our motto is service and we try our best to serve the downtrodden.

Higher Secondary Section

The higher secondary section of SRKGVMHSS Puranattukara was started in June 1998 when Swami Sakranandaji Maharaj was the manager of the school and the president of the Sri Ramakrishna Math. The name in full reads Sri Ramakrishna Gurukula Vidya Mandir Higher Secondary School.It began with one science, commerce and humanities batch each. In 1999 one more science batch was allotted and presently the school has 4 batches. It has a total strength of 398 students who are educated by 21 teachers supported by 4 non-teaching staff. The Principal is the academic and administrative head of the higher secondary section.

Courses and Subjects Combinations

The higher secondary section offers three course covering 15 subjects. The admission to the higher secondary courses is done in the month of June according to the rules and regulations of the Department of Higher Secondary Education, Kerala.

  • Science (100 Seats) –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Mathematics, Second Language and English.
  • Commerce (50 seats) – Business Studies, Accountancy, Economics, Mathematics, Second Language and English.
  • Humanities (50 seats) – History, Sociology, Economics, Malayalam, Second Language and English.
